Output 0c546a9031156aecaf675421cdb3ae32516454ab2d2eb3702a9e9aa261aba8fc:156

value
3552832
script pubkey
OP_0 OP_PUSHBYTES_20 d8d58a10bd394d7f71863f82c406de122bd9b6ec
address
bc1qmr2c5y9a89xh7uvx87pvgpk7zg4andhv656d2t
transaction
0c546a9031156aecaf675421cdb3ae32516454ab2d2eb3702a9e9aa261aba8fc